Copplestone is a small, unmanned station. There is no ticket office or machine at the station, so purchasing tickets in advance online is essential. It's worth noting there's no facility for collecting tickets bought online here. While there is no waiting room, a seating area is available for those moments before your train arrives. The station offers step-free access, though wheelchair users might find it challenging to board trains due to narrow platforms. A customer help point is available, ensuring help is on hand if needed.
With no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, travelers should plan accordingly. For assistance or inquiries, patrons can reach out to the GWR Help & Support.

Despite its small size, Water Orton station is equipped to handle the essentials. There is no ticket office, but 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ets bought online, making your journey just a tap away. However, it's important to note that these machines are not equipped with accessibility features, so plan ahead if you require additional assistance. An induction loop is available, enhancing the station’s aid for those with hearing aids.
Travelers will find a help point for any questions or concerns, though staffed assistance is unavailable. Step-free access is offered in certain parts of the station, but a full barrier-free experience is lacking, categorized as a step-free access category C station. There are no waiting rooms or first-class lounges, but the venue ensures basic seating arrangements are in place for your comfort.
Water Orton station acts as a link in the local transportation web. In case of engineering work or interruptions, replacement bus services will collect passengers from Birmingham Road's public stops.
